Transaction cd156ce3873be4e875f93410e7cfe20cc24fcc5efa4cc80a286d41dcaec1502f

1 Input
2 Outputs
  • cd156ce3873be4e875f93410e7cfe20cc24fcc5efa4cc80a286d41dcaec1502f:0
  • value  107650148
    address  36U9rgNxJfvvrkD79vEBgcS959YruyaP8A
  • cd156ce3873be4e875f93410e7cfe20cc24fcc5efa4cc80a286d41dcaec1502f:1
  • value  18427624
    address  1APJco7RuNcEkVx1PuharxjCq98pDQoGjU